Willow publishes one price — $399 a month — with no membership, no tiers and no introductory rate that expires. In a market this cluttered, that clarity is worth something.
It is not worth $2,400 a year, though, which is roughly the gap between Willow and the cheapest full-dose compounded tirzepatide in our table.
How the dose ladder is handled
There is less published detail here than at larger competitors about how dose changes are reviewed and how quickly you can reach a clinician. For a programme where the whole pitch is simplicity, that is a notable gap.
| Tirzepatide doses | Step up roughly every |
|---|---|
| 2.5 mg → 5 mg → 7.5 mg → 10 mg → 12.5 mg → 15 mg | 4 weeks |
| Price changes as you climb? | Check before you start |

What it costs
About $4,788 a year.
| Willow · tirzepatide | |
|---|---|
| Advertised from | $399/mo |
| Membership on top | None |
| What you actually pay | $399/mo |
| Over a year | $4,788 |
One published rate, no membership layer.

How it scored
Willow scores 2.9 out of 5, placing it 20 of 21 for tirzepatide. The weights are published on how we rate and fixed before we assess anyone.
| What we weigh | Weight | Score |
|---|---|---|
| True monthly cost | 30% | 2.4 / 5 |
| Price honesty | 20% | 3 / 5 |
| Clinical support | 20% | 3.1 / 5 |
| Pharmacy sourcing | 15% | 3.1 / 5 |
| Cancelling | 15% | 3 / 5 |
Our verdict
One clear number, priced well above the market. Ask about dose changes, clinician access and pharmacy sourcing before committing.
